Mountain View, signed on the platform as Mountain View–Wayne, is a station on the Montclair–Boonton Line of NJ Transit in Wayne, New Jersey. Prior to the Montclair Connection in 2002, the station was served by the Boonton Line. Mountain View station is situated 2 miles south of The Friendship Circle of Passaic County.

Lincoln Park Airport is a privately owned, public use airport located two nautical miles north of the central business district of Lincoln Park, in Morris County, New Jersey, United States. Lincoln Park Airport is situated 2½ miles west of The Friendship Circle of Passaic County.

Lincoln Park is a station on NJ Transit's Montclair–Boonton Line in the borough of Lincoln Park, Morris County, New Jersey. The station is located near the Comly Road overpass, accessible from Main Street, Station Road and Park Avenue. Lincoln Park station is situated 2½ miles southwest of The Friendship Circle of Passaic County.

Packanack Lake is an unincorporated lake community and census-designated place in Wayne in Passaic County, in the U.S. state of New Jersey. The community is located 30 minutes northwest of Manhattan.

Wayne is a township in Passaic County, in the U.S. state of New Jersey. Home to William Paterson University and located less than 20 miles from Midtown Manhattan, the township is a bedroom suburb of New York City and regional commercial hub of North Jersey.

Pequannock Township is a township in Morris County, in the U.S. state of New Jersey. As of the 2020 United States census, the township's population was 15,571, an increase of 31 from the 2010 census count of 15,540, which in turn reflected an increase of 1,652 from the 13,888 counted in the 2000 census. Pequannock is situated 1½ miles northwest of The Friendship Circle of Passaic County.
